Appraising, directly selling weapons and the ability to remove skills weren't available initially: the only way to sell weapons before the 1.5 update was if you hit the weapon cap and the other 2 options didn't exist at all. The maximum number of allowed skills hasn't been increased since the game was released and has always been dependent on the weapon tiers: tier 1 weapons can only have 3 skills, tier 2 weapons can have 6 and tier 3 weapons can have the maximum possible 8.

One thing I'm not sure anyone has really mentioned is I was noticing you were actively picking up weapon and material bags. Let me make your life simple by saying this: You don't have too! The game will automatically scoop up any bag still on the field at the end of a completed battle. I have tested this by not picking up weapon bags and still getting 3-4 weapons in the result screen. To me, the worst thing about The Imprisoned is that you can only do half of its weak point damage in one iteration - whenever it hits halfway, even if it's seconds after it fell down, it'll recover immediately. It almost always does its belly-sliding charge after that, which takes a long time and hits pretty hard, and then you have to wait for its toes to regrow before you can attack it again. If it wants to be a real jerk, it can eat up a lot of time when you're going for an A-rank, and you need to keep a lot of SP to take it down quickly. There was one mission where I actually let it hit me just so I could drink potions to recover my SP, because I could afford the damage but was running out of time. It's the only time "take damage to save time" has worked for me. Fortunately, in Legend mode, the Groosenator does so much damage that you don't even need to chase The Imprisoned down - you can just let it arrive at each keep and shoot it down, then hit its weak point and kill it that way.
